Warning Signs You Need Roof Leak Water Removal

Roof leaks can be sneaky, but there are often warning signs that show a problem.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ars in damages and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a musty or mildewy smell in your home that won’t go away, it may be a sign of a roof leak. This is especially true if the smell is coming from a specific area, such as a ceiling or wall.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ling

Water stains on your ceiling can be a sign of a roof leak, especially if they’re accompanied by a musty smell. These stains can be caused by water seeping through your roof and onto your ceiling.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of a roof leak, especially if it’s accompanied by water stains or a musty smell. This is often caused by water seeping through your roof and onto your floors.

Discoloration or Peeling Paint

Discoloration or peeling paint on your walls or ceiling can be a sign of a roof leak. This is often caused by water seeping through your roof and onto your walls.

Unusual Sounds or Leaks

Unusual sounds or leaks in your roof can be a sign of a problem. This may include dripping water, creaking sounds, or other unusual noises.

Visible Water Damage

Visible water damage, such as water pooling or standing water, can be a sign of a roof leak. This is often caused by water seeping through your roof and onto your floors or walls.

Roof Leak Water Removal Cost In Decatur, TX

The cost of roof leak water removal can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. In general, you can expect to pay between $500 and $2,500 or more, depending on the extent of the damage. Factors that can affect the cost include: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and drying $500-$1,500 Size of affected area, amount of water, and equipment needed
Repair and reconstruction $1,000-$3,000 Extent of damage, materials needed, and labor required
Mold and mildew remediation $500-$1,000 Severity of mold and mildew growth, equipment needed, and labor required
Structural repair and reinforcement $2,000-$5,000 Extent of structural damage, materials needed, and labor required
Electrical and plumbing repairs $1,000-$3,000 Severity of electrical or plumbing issues, materials needed, and labor required
More services (e.g. Cleaning, disinfecting) $500-$1,000 Scope of more services needed

Common Questions About Roof Leak Water Removal

Q: How long will it take to remove the water and dry out my home?

A: The time it takes to remove the water and dry out your home depends on the severity and size of the affected area. In general, we can complete the process within 3-5 days. But, this can vary depending on the extent of the damage and the equipment needed.

Q: Will I need to replace my roof?

A: Not necessarily. While roof leaks can be a sign of a larger issue, not all roof leaks need a full roof replacement. Our team will assess the damage and provide recommendations for repair or replacement.
